FreeToken PR adds Apple Silicon Metal and MLX backend support
jasonkneen · x · 2026-08-23
A Pull Request for FreeToken introduces Metal backend support for Apple Silicon. This branch enables running FreeToken on Macs without CUDA by routing to the Metal backend (MLX or llama.cpp). The install script adapts to macOS arm64 for M1-M4 chips and includes verified test cases.
